wl12xx: replace all remaining wl->vif references
wl->vif is appropriate only when a single vif is being used. Instead, pass wlvif as parameter or iterate through all the vifs (e.g. when a global configuration was changed) Leave wl->vif only to determine whether a vif was already added (this check will be removed as well after both the driver and fw will support multiple vifs) Signed-off-by: Eliad Peller <eliad@wizery.com> Signed-off-by: Luciano Coelho <coelho@ti.com>
